Taiwan: China continues military exercise

Aircraft and ships engaged in anti-submarine drills and assault in Taiwan Strait

Means of Beijing's Air Force and Navy are conducting anti-submarine attack and assault demonstration actions in the Taiwan Strait. The Chinese Armed Forces exercises were expected to end on Sunday, after a five-day training exercise that has virtually isolated Taipei and hampered air and sea transport. 

From Beijing, the eastern theater command of the People's Liberation Army (Pla) disclosed in these hours that military maneuvers are continuing today in the sea and airspace around Taiwan, "focusing on organizing joint anti-submarine and maritime assault operations", said a note.

On Tuesday, Beijing had kicked off exercises in the north, southwest and east of the island. A response to a visit to the island by US House of Representatives Speaker Nancy Pelosi. So far, however, there has been no formal word of any cessation of Chinese demonstration actions. The United States and Japan claim that Beijing has found an excuse to make such exercises daily.
